Festa da Cebola 2026: A Taste of Local Tradition in Caniço
While massive agricultural celebrations happen across the globe—such as the famous National Onion Festival in Ituporanga, Brazil—the heart of Madeira’s own onion harvest belongs strictly to the parish of Caniço. Returning from May 15th to 17th, 2026, the annual Festa da Cebola (Onion Festival) stands as one of the most traditional, representative, and beloved cultural highlights of the Santa Cruz region. Spearheaded by the Junta de Freguesia do Caniço, this vibrant three-day event brings the community together to honor its deep-rooted farming heritage and celebrate the island's sweet, locally grown "Caniceira" onion.
- Dates: May 15 – 17, 2026
- Location: Centro do Caniço, Santa Cruz Region, Madeira
- Key Attractions: Traditional Agricultural Parade & Multi-day Gastronomic Exhibition
The Traditional Allegorical Parade & Auction
The absolute highlight of the weekend is the iconic agricultural parade. The streets of central Caniço fill with music, color, and a spectacular procession of tractors and wooden carts beautifully decorated entirely with locally harvested onions. Following the lively parade, visitors can witness or participate in the traditional leilão (public auction). Here, the finest agricultural entries are auctioned off to the highest bidder, keeping a centuries-old community custom thriving while showcasing the hard work of the region's dedicated farmers.
Gastronomy & Madeiran Arraial Entertainment
No local festival is complete without the sensory experiences of a true Madeiran arraial (street party). Throughout the three-day event, central Caniço transforms into a bustling market hub. Visitors have the unique opportunity to:
Sample authentic regional dishes featuring the sweet local harvest.
Browse extensive agricultural exhibitions showcasing the best regional produce.
Enjoy a rich lineup of live musical concerts, cultural acts, and traditional dance performances, including features like the "Remember Old Times" project.
